For outdoor enthusiasts, Gainesboro is a paradise. Surrounded by lush forests, sparkling lakes, and winding rivers, the town offers endless opportunities for hiking, fishing, boating, and other outdoor activities. With easy access to the Cumberland River and Cordell Hull Lake, residents can enjoy water sports and scenic views right in their own backyard.
